Art talk with Jono Terry and Austin Kaluba

An art talk with Jono Terry and renowned writer and Journalist Austin Kaluba at Everyday Lusaka Gallery, following the opening of Terry’s debut solo exhibition in Zambia entitled β€œBetween Two Shores” curated by Sana Ginwalla.

In β€œBetween Two Shores”, Terry sensitively captures the loss of ancestral land, including burial grounds that irreparably changed not only social fabrics that held people together, but also the ecosystem as they knew it. As a white Zimbabwean descended from British settlers, Terry occupies a complex position from which to examine questions of history, belonging, and inherited responsibility.

The talk will be an opportunity to converse with the artist before his departure from Zambia and learn more about the conception of this seminal project.
